 MAXIMUM RATINGS (Ta=25                 )
 TRANSISTOR Q1
                       CHARACTERISTIC                             SYMBOL                     RATING                                       UNIT
   Collector-Base Voltage                                          VCBO                           -15                                      V
   Collector-Emitter Voltage                                       VCEO                           -12                                      V
   Emitter-Base Voltage                                            VEBO                               -6
                                                                       IC                         -500
   Collector Current
                                                                       ICP *                          -1                                   A
   Collector Power Dissipation                                         PC                         100
   Junction Temperature                                                Tj                         150
   Storage Temperature Range                                       Tstg                       -55~125


 DIODE (SBD) D1
                       CHARACTERISTIC                             SYMBOL                     RATING                                       UNIT
   Maximum (Peak) Reverse Voltage                                  VRM                                30                                   V
   Reverse Voltage                                                  VR                                30                                   V
   Maximum (Peak) Forward Current                                   IFM                           300
   Average Forward Current                                             IO                         200
   Surge Current (10mS)                                            IFSM                               1                                    A
   Junction Temperature                                                Tj                         125
   Storage Temperature Range                                       Tstg                      -55 125

 ELECTRICAL CHARACTERISTICS (Ta=25 )
 TRANSISTOR Q1
             CHARACTERISTIC                  SYMBOL                 TEST CONDITION   MIN.   TYP.   MAX.   UNIT
   Collector Cut-off Current                    ICBO      VCB=-15V, IE=0              -      -     -100
   Collector-Base Breakdown Voltage           V(BR)CBO    IE=-10                     -15     -      -      V
   Collector-Emitter Breakdown Voltage        V(BR)CEO    IC=-1                      -12     -      -      V
   Emitter-Base Breakdown Voltage             V(BR)EBO    IE=-10                      -6     -      -      V
   DC Current Gain                                  hFE   VCE=-2V, IC=-10            270     -     680     -
   Collector-Emitter Saturation Voltage       VCE(SAT)    IC=-200   , IB=-10          -     -100   -250
   Transition Frequency                             fT    VCE=-2V, IC=-10 , f=100     -     260     -
   Collector Output Capacitance                     Cob   VCB=-10V, IE=0, f=1         -     6.5     -




 DIODE (SBD) D1

             CHARACTERISTIC                  SYMBOL                 TEST CONDITION   MIN.   TYP.   MAX.   UNIT
                                                VF(1)     IF=1mA                      -     0.22    -
                                                VF(2)     IF=10mA                     -     0.29    -
   Forward Voltage                                                                                         V
                                                VF(3)     IF=100mA                    -     0.38    -
                                                VF(4)     IF=200mA                    -     0.43   0.55
   Reverse Current                                  IR    VR=30V                      -      -      50
   Total Capacitance                                CT    VR=0, f=1                   -      50     -
